English to English

seashore
('s/i/,/S//oU/r )

noun (n)

  • the shore of a sea or ocean(noun.object)
    source: wordnet30
  • The coast of the sea; the land that lies adjacent to the sea or ocean.(noun)
    source: webster1913
Advertisement

Bookmark This Site